Children’s Play, Learning and Development (BTEC)

Children are the future, and you could be a part of that.

Our incredibly successful Children’s Play, Learning and Development course gives you the opportunity to start on your journey in becoming a childcare professional.

You will study how children think and develop from birth through to adolescence. This 2-year course will build on the exploration of these key principles of development milestones from birth to adolescence. Child development is an exciting journey to experience, covering a broad range of skills areas including:

* Physical (motor) skills

* Speech and language

* Social and emotional

* Cognitive and intellectual abilities.

The course covers a wide range of developmental areas as well as having an in-depth look into how professionals within Early Years settings use the Early Years Foundation Stage to encourage development within the young.

A key part of the course is that not only will you learn the theory behind the development of young people, but you will get to apply this during a series of work placements as you carry out a minimum of 50 hours throughout the course. You can, of course, do more!

You will study ‘children’s development’, the ‘development of children’s communication, literacy and numeracy skills’, their ‘play and learning’ and the ‘Early Years Foundation Stage’

As a BTEC qualification you will produce a range of coursework assignments as well as complete external examinations. You will have the option to re-sit some examinations if you wish to.
